SYNC at West Dallas is seeking an experienced Maintenance Technician to join our service team! Candidates must have at least 3 years of apartment maintenance experience with strong HVAC, appliance, plumbing, and electrical troubleshooting and repair skills, the ability to clearly communicate repair options and schedules to residents to set appropriate expectations, and take pride in completing repairs correctly the first time.
This role is also responsible for completing make‑readies, including interior paint touch‑ups, carpet cleaning, and other items as outlined on the make‑ready checklist. Valid driver’s license and bi‑weekly on‑call rotation participation required.

Responsible for maintaining the cleaned and repaired condition of the property interiors, exteriors, and site using company‑supplied materials and equipment and following manufacturer’s directions for the same. Provides support and rotates emergency calls with the Maintenance Lead. This is a line position with direct impact on company funds.
- Monitor and assist completion of make‑ready units
- Troubleshoot, diagnose, and correct minor air conditioning failures (e.g., low freon, bad compressor, fan motors). EPA certified. Ensure filters are replaced in a timely manner. Assist with replacing complete systems as needed. Perform air conditioning repairs and replacements in compliance with federal regulations.
- Troubleshoot, diagnose, and correct minor heating failures (e.g., replace heat strips, exchangers, thermo‑couplings, boilers, tube bundles). Complete preventative maintenance as necessary.
- Troubleshoot diagnoses and correct minor appliance failures (e.g., replace dishwasher motors, garbage disposals, ice makers, stove elements, thermo‑couplings).
- Repair minor electrical problems (e.g., replace switches, receptacles, fixtures). May work with high voltage 110‑220 V.
- Repair minor plumbing problems (e.g., replace bibs, seats, pop‑up assemblies, operate sewer machines, sweat copper lines, maintain boiler logs).
- Provide minor carpentry, glass and sheet‑rock repairs (e.g., remove/replace door frames, patch holes in sheet rock, apply texture, repair sub‑floors, repair cabinets).
- Assist in monitoring inventory of maintenance and cleaning supplies, facilitating accurate replacement orders.
- Perform necessary repairs and preventative maintenance on rental units as they become vacant, maintain adequate supply of rental units ready for occupancy, and assist in painting and finishing of interior units, office, clubhouse, laundry rooms, and common areas.
- Repair, patch, and re‑stretch carpet; install vinyl or sheet goods.
- Re‑key locks and cut keys.
